Day 3 – Realejo, Albaicín and Sacromonte
After breakfast, a tour of the Realejo district, the old Jewish quarter between the Darro and Genil rivers, south of the Albaicín. Visits include Isabel la Católica Square, the San Francisco Convent, the Sephardic Museum, the Carmen de los Mártires, the Torres Bermejas, and the Campo del Príncipe. In the afternoon, walk through the Albaicín and Sacromonte. Dinner and overnight in the host family.
